Vishnu travelled equal distances at speeds of 10 km/hr, 30 km/hr and 8 km/hr, respectively and took a total of 15.5 minutes to complete. Find the total distance he travelled (in km).

Explanation

Let distance be D for each leg. Total time = D/10 + D/30 + D/8 = 15.5/60 hours. (12D + 4D + 15D) / 120 = 15.5/60. 31D / 120 = 15.5 / 60. 31D = 31. D = 1. Total distance = 3D = 3 km.
